Job Title: SEND Teaching Assistant
From £89/day | EYFS | Tower Hamlets | September Start | Full-Time | Long-Term An Ofsted-rated Good nursery in Tower Hamlets is seeking a compassionate SEN Teaching Assistant to support a child with speech and language delay. The setting has a nurturing ethos and strong links with local speech therapy services. Excellent transport links make commuting straightforward. In this role, you will be: • Supporting a child in nursery with speech and language needs. • Using visual prompts, repetition, and play-based strategies. • Encouraging social interaction and confidence in communication. • Working with the SENCO and external agencies. What we’re looking for: • Experience in early years and SEN. • A warm, patient and caring nature. • Familiarity with early communication support strategies.
